1.1 A bill for an act 1.2 relating to highway traffic regulations; prohibiting 1.3 the transport of animals in motor vehicles unless 1.4 protected or secured; proposing coding for new law in 1.5 Minnesota Statutes, chapter 169. 1.6 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A: 1.7 Section 1. [169.431] [TRANSPORTATION OF ANIMALS IN MOTOR 1.8 VEHICLES.] 1.9 Subdivision 1. [RESTRICTIONS.] A person shall not 1.10 transport an animal in the back of a motor vehicle in a space 1.11 intended for a load on the vehicle on a public roadway unless 1.12 (1) the space is enclosed, (2) the space has side and tail racks 1.13 to a height of at least 46 inches extending vertically from the 1.14 floor, (3) the animal is cross tethered to the vehicle, (4) the 1.15 animal is protected by a secured container or cage, or (5) the 1.16 animal is otherwise protected in a manner that prevents the 1.17 animal from falling, jumping, or being thrown from the vehicle. 1.18 Subd. 2. [EXCEPTIONS.] Notwithstanding subdivision 1, this 1.19 section does not apply to: 1.20 (1) a dog being transported by a farmer or farm employee 1.21 who is engaged in agricultural activities requiring the services 1.22 of a dog; or 1.23 (2) a hunting dog at a hunting site or being transported 1.24 between hunting sites by a licensed hunter who is in possession 1.25 of all applicable licenses and permits for the species being 2.1 pursued during the legal season for that activity.
